[PATCH] D46850: [DebugInfo] Generate fixups as emitting DWARF .debug_line.

Paul Robinson via Phabricator via llvm-commits llvm-commits at lists.llvm.org
Tue May 22 10:56:10 PDT 2018


probinson added inline comments.


================
Comment at: lib/MC/MCAssembler.cpp:951
+      const MCBinaryExpr *ABE = cast_or_null<MCBinaryExpr>(&DF.getAddrDelta());
+      assert(ABE && "We expect address delta is a binary expression.");
+      FixupExpr = ABE->getLHS();
----------------
Why not `cast<MCBinaryExpr>` and skip the assertion?


Repository:
  rL LLVM

https://reviews.llvm.org/D46850





More information about the llvm-commits mailing list